Following Saturday’s 0-0 draw at home against Sunderland in League One, I asked the Vital Lincoln City members what three things they learned from the match.

Here’s what Chimpimp said:

1. We have a tall agile goalkeeper on our books with excellent distribution skills. Josh Griffiths is however injured. When Jordan Wright entered the fray in the final minutes again Sheffield Wednesday, few knew what to expect from him but while he might not yet looked quite as polished as the England U21 player, Griffiths would have been proud of the point saving stop Wright produced in the dying minutes against Sunderland.

2. We look to be more flexible with our tactics. With a stronger defence following the return Walsh and Jackson, giving the opposition more of the ball by playing longer, is an option. However, Lincoln looked most threatening when they got the ball down and played a bit more football in the final quarter.

3. Morgan Whittaker is a good impact sub who can affect the game. However, looking at the impact he did have, Lincoln need to find a way to make the most of his talents. Perhaps the next three away games with more room and counter-attacking possibilities, will give him that chance.
